Publishers include Virgin Interactive[4] and Titus Interactive[5].
Publication
Publication dates include April 6, 2001[28] and July 16, 2015[29]. Languages include English[21], French[22], Italian[23], German[24], Spanish[25], and Danish[26]. Genres include strategy video game[6] and artillery game[7]. Worms World Party's part of the series is recorded as Worms[11]. Recorded distribution format include CD-ROM[30] and digital distribution[31].
